
In a landmark diplomatic decision that underscores India's evolving engagement with Afghanistan, New Delhi has officially elevated its technical mission in Kabul to the status of a full-fledged embassy with immediate effect.
The upgrade represents a significant strategic shift in India's foreign policy approach toward Afghanistan, moving from technical cooperation to comprehensive diplomatic representation. This development comes after careful assessment of the regional geopolitical landscape and India's long-term interests in Central Asia.
Strategic Implications of the Embassy Upgrade
The transformation from a technical mission to an embassy carries substantial symbolic and practical weight. An embassy status provides India with enhanced diplomatic capabilities, including broader engagement with Afghan authorities, improved consular services for Indian citizens, and stronger bilateral coordination on security and economic matters.
This move demonstrates India's commitment to maintaining an active diplomatic presence in Afghanistan despite regional challenges. The upgraded mission will now function with full diplomatic privileges and immunities, enabling more robust political dialogue and cooperation.
Historical Context and Bilateral Relations
India and Afghanistan share deep historical and cultural ties that span centuries. The relationship has weathered numerous geopolitical shifts, with India consistently supporting Afghanistan's development through various infrastructure projects, educational initiatives, and humanitarian assistance.
The technical mission, which preceded this upgrade, primarily focused on maintaining limited diplomatic channels and overseeing India's development projects in the country. Its elevation to embassy status marks a new chapter in the bilateral relationship, potentially opening doors for expanded cooperation in trade, security, and cultural exchange.
